Commit graph

276 commits

Author SHA1 Message Date
norayr
0d215c650b darwin bootstrap binary update. -- noch 2015-03-19 19:54:44 +08:00
norayr
fd1fb21e8b updated arm bootstrap binary 2015-03-07 06:50:31 +00:00
norayr
929f688a9e reverted system type changes, added warning for absent else in case, -- noch 2015-03-19 15:33:10 +04:00
norayr
a6d8def2da unified makefiles; updated linux clang x86_64 bootstrap binary. -- noch 2015-03-17 13:49:31 +04:00
norayr
f2f45f8959 almost nothing -- noch 2015-03-17 13:39:48 +04:00
norayr
c53c06a035 updated x86 linux bootstrap binary. -- noch. 2015-03-17 13:31:14 +04:00
norayr
63a0f765a7 new system types on darwin: updated bootstrap binary. -- noch. 2015-03-17 17:24:05 +08:00
norayr
5ffcb31ab6 freebsd bootstrap binary update -- noch 2015-03-16 20:21:44 +00:00
norayr
4d576a5a2e updated faq about freebsd related common issue. -- noch 2015-03-16 19:45:22 +00:00
norayr
d3dd4afda4 arm bootstrap binary updated. -- noch 2015-03-04 14:37:31 +00:00
norayr
03adfacbfb fixed showdef.Mod -- noch 2015-03-16 17:54:15 +04:00
norayr
fd682d9c02 maxIdLen in OPS.Mod changed. showdef was unable to show definitions of
ulmRandomGenerators.Mod because full path
/opt/voc-1.1/lib/voc/sym/ulmRand... was longer than 32. Now fixed. -- noch
2015-03-16 17:33:37 +04:00
norayr
26542b84df Merge branch 'new-system-types'
Conflicts:
	voc
2015-03-16 17:24:25 +04:00
norayr
aa7a4d56aa updated x86 bootstrap binary. -- noch 2015-03-16 17:20:36 +04:00
norayr
42ecf2464c on line 605 of OPT.Mod typ := impCtxt.ref[-tag] read let's say, 19, i.
e. int64 typ, but because in procedure Close set to NIL everything upper
than FirstRef, which is 16, that's why obj.typ was not set in InStruct,
which caused crash later.
for now fixed by starting to NIL array from Comp + 1, not from FirstRef.
changing FirstRef causes crashes, which I did not investigate yet.

-- noch
2015-03-12 21:39:13 +04:00
Norayr Chilingarian
ab5d3f734e added oocRandomNumbers, updated newt wrapper with GetKey function. -- noch 2015-03-12 00:24:11 +04:00
Norayr Chilingarian
fb960f552f updated OPV Convert to support 64bit type. -- noch 2015-03-11 20:26:05 +04:00
Norayr Chilingarian
fe36147392 small addition in system functions 2015-03-11 19:05:45 +04:00
Norayr Chilingarian
d3b0c0352a OPT cleanup. 2015-03-11 18:53:26 +04:00
Norayr Chilingarian
a2e64ff15f fixed forceNewSym/Verbose mistake, working on new types relations. -- noch 2015-03-11 18:49:01 +04:00
Norayr Chilingarian
747943b008 introducing new integer types in SYSTEM module. -- noch. 2015-03-11 14:03:49 +04:00
Norayr Chilingarian
0aecdbd935 added newt example with buttons. updated newt wrapper. -- noch. 2015-03-11 02:13:06 +04:00
Norayr Chilingarian
712244b161 Revert "added SYSTEM.INT8, SYSTEM.INT16, SYSTEM.INT32, SYSTEM.INT64. tested only"
This reverts commit 38794808ac.
2015-03-10 19:32:11 +04:00
Norayr Chilingarian
b899460455 Revert "new system types tested on x86 and armv6, bootstrap binaries updated. --"
This reverts commit 5a6725d7da.
2015-03-10 19:31:57 +04:00
Norayr Chilingarian
5a6725d7da new system types tested on x86 and armv6, bootstrap binaries updated. --
noch
2015-02-27 19:46:36 +04:00
Norayr Chilingarian
38794808ac added SYSTEM.INT8, SYSTEM.INT16, SYSTEM.INT32, SYSTEM.INT64. tested only
on x86_64 yet. -- noch
2015-02-27 19:08:57 +04:00
Norayr Chilingarian
8d73a74432 newt wrapper -- noch 2015-02-22 01:56:44 +04:00
Norayr Chilingarian
669735779f beautified wrapper -- noch 2015-02-21 14:49:37 +04:00
Norayr Chilingarian
08668e2495 newt binding updated -- noch 2015-02-21 14:23:26 +04:00
Norayr Chilingarian
034808deb8 newt binding, first demo - hello world application -- noch 2015-02-21 04:38:14 +04:00
Norayr Chilingarian
749d45d439 darwin unix.mod update -- noch 2015-02-19 18:12:00 +04:00
Norayr Chilingarian
606c23d096 got rid of ecvt completely. reals.mod and texts test updated. -- noch 2015-02-18 16:51:40 +04:00
norayr
6865671d76 freebsd makefile updated with -F flag to force create symbol files -- noch 2015-02-13 11:41:25 +00:00
norayr
2aeb9f7424 fixed makefile ld.so.conf.d for freebsd. -- noch 2015-02-13 11:31:35 +00:00
norayr
9f452e66b7 unix module now compiles under freebsd -- noch 2015-02-13 11:18:29 +00:00
Norayr Chilingarian
6ace15a0dc Files are architecture dependent, texts are not. cleaned this up. --
noch
2015-02-13 14:23:13 +04:00
Norayr Chilingarian
3977329475 freebsd work mostly -- noch 2015-02-13 13:49:28 +04:00
Norayr Chilingarian
2bd826c965 got rid of ecvt outdated function. -- noch 2015-02-13 02:23:22 +04:00
Norayr Chilingarian
af98fae2f1 fixed bug, forgot to new text. -- noch 2015-02-12 21:00:49 +04:00
Norayr Chilingarian
63dc2c5c31 ported ethDates, ethReals, ethStrings. -- noch 2015-02-12 20:21:39 +04:00
Norayr Chilingarian
74a518efe9 small fix of typo in comment. -- noch 2015-02-12 19:35:01 +04:00
Norayr Chilingarian
29d62cf1b0 added comment -- noch 2015-02-10 18:43:31 +04:00
Norayr Chilingarian
3e88d51eb6 ulmToInt16 now works -- noch 2015-02-10 18:33:47 +04:00
Norayr Chilingarian
451bb287fe unufied makefiles 2015-02-10 18:06:41 +04:00
Norayr Chilingarian
59e489ea43 x86_86 gcc/clang low level modules update, types clarified. -- noch 2015-02-10 15:06:04 +04:00
Norayr Chilingarian
305c759d79 modified COMPILE, added dependencies. -- noch 2015-02-09 21:46:33 +04:00
Norayr Chilingarian
8b8dd6fd14 __DEL(x) should be defined as free(x) because we don't use alloca() call -- noch 2015-02-09 21:08:34 +04:00
Norayr Chilingarian
aaa2ee2288 finished removing unnecessary architecture files -- noch 2015-02-09 19:53:12 +04:00
Norayr Chilingarian
caa0071d90 removed armv6j and armv7a_hardfp targets, armv6j_hardfp can be used
instead.
2015-02-09 19:06:14 +04:00
norayr
cfad61c8f7 updated raspberry bootstrap image and makefile. 2015-01-31 22:06:56 +00:00